Description

Handwritten lyrics for an oft-covered Dylan classic: "Knock knock knocking on Heaven's door"

Hugely desirable handwritten lyrics by Bob Dylan for his popular song, "Knocking on Heaven's Door," one page, 5.25 x 8, The Carlyle letterhead, written in black ballpoint and signed neatly at the conclusion, "Bob Dylan, 2009."

In very fine condition. Accompanied by a 2013 letter of authenticity from Jeff Rosen, president of the Bob Dylan Music Company, in full: "I have represented Bob Dylan for the past 35 years. This letter will certify that the lyrics to Knockin' on Heaven's Door contained herein are original Bob Dylan manuscripts, written in his own hand on Carlyle New York hotel stationery. To the best of my knowledge, there are only five of these manuscripts that exist as of the date of this letter."

Composed by Dylan for the soundtrack of the 1973 film Pat Garrett and Billy the Kid, 'Knockin' on Heaven's Door' was released as a single two months after the film's premiere and became a worldwide hit. It remains one of Dylan's most enduring and oft-covered songs from the 1970s, with popular recordings by the likes of Guns N' Roses, Eric Clapton, and Randy Crawford. With just two short verses and a chorus, Dylan biographer Clinton Heylin described the song as 'an exercise in splendid simplicity.'
